How can I connect my ASUS ROG G751 JT laptop with Intel AC 7620 wireless to TP Link Deco X68 mesh network that is not showing on available networks?

In order to recognize WiFi 6/6e routers, you need to ensure that you have the last release of the 7260 driver installed. You can download this from my share: Legacy Wireless Drivers.
